Butternut Squash Waffle Sausage Egg and Cheese Sandwich
A cozy sweet-savory breakfast sandwich made with butternut squash waffles, a crispy sausage patty, melted cheese, and a warm hot honey drizzle. Perfect for fall mornings or a fun brunch idea
Yield: 1 Sandwich
Prep Time: 10 minutes
Cook Time: 10 minutes
Special Equipment: Mini Waffle Maker
Ingredients
½ cup mashed butternut squash
1 egg
2 tablespoons almond flour or regular flour
Pinch of salt
½ teaspoon cinnamon
Nonstick spray
1 sausage patty
1 egg for frying
1 slice American cheese or cheddar
2 tablespoons honey
¼ to ½ teaspoon red pepper flakes
Directions
Heat a mini waffle maker and spray with nonstick then mix squash egg flour salt and cinnamon until smooth and cook waffles 3 to 4 minutes each until golden.
Cook the sausage patty in a skillet over medium heat until browned on both sides.
Fry the egg to your liking and melt the cheese on top.
Assemble the sandwich by stacking waffle sausage egg and cheese then top with the second waffle.
Warm honey and stir in red pepper flakes then drizzle over the sandwich and serve.
